What's a Takeover-- and How Is It Different in Charlotte?
For those brand-new to the term, a car takeover generally describes a team of drivers blocking off intersections, parking lots, or streets to carry out stunts like donuts, exhaustions, and racing. While these events have acquired popularity across the country, many cities associate them with prohibited tasks and unsafe driving.

Yet Charlotte is seeing a change. The regional neighborhood, led by groups like Cars Across Charlotte, is bringing structure and accountability to the scene. With a focus on safety and security, lawful locations, and crowd control, these events are being rebranded as legal requisitions-- providing motorists and spectators a place to have fun without taking the chance of tickets, impoundments, or even worse.

Rather than combating the culture, coordinators are functioning to legitimize it. With collaborations with local police, location owners, and noticeable names in the area, events are being changed from dangerous pop-up stunts to full-on experiences that highlight both autos and culture.
